Under the McKinney-Vento Homeless Act, families or students in the following situations are homeless and are eligible for special rights: in a shelter, motel, vehicle or campground on the street, 24-hour restaurant, or bus station, displaced due to natural or manmade disaster (flood, earthquake, fire) living in a motel, abandoned building, trailer or other inadequate accommodations, living with friends or relatives due to the inability to find affordable housing "couch surfing" teenager living on his/her own

Description

May be able to provides homeless families and students, including unaccompanied youth, the following services:   Assistance with school registration, even if the family or student is missing documentation such as birth certificate and immunization records.   Automatic free lunch and breakfast if available, without the need to fill out that particular form.   Assistance with keeping the student in the same school, even after moving, sometimes even if the move is to another school district.   Assistance with transportation to and from school in the form of school buses, gas vouchers, or city bus passes.   Free school supplies if needed.   Free school clothes if needed.   Referrals to other services as needed.  These services continue through the end of the school year in which homelessness ends.
